Transaction 7660ac8d79819953794e021ba22ba77cd7c5f8c89a3a3838cdca5d6194652602

1 Input
1 Outputs
  • 7660ac8d79819953794e021ba22ba77cd7c5f8c89a3a3838cdca5d6194652602:0
  • value  632392
    address  15ekteEwjoZKEV2xPFCSec1XkdVxF3LNHQ